Mittersill / Pass Thurn, set between the Kitzbühel Alps and the Hohe Tauern National Park, offers discerning buyers a unique blend of refined Alpine living and pristine natural beauty. This area is prized for its access to world-class skiing, authentic Austrian ambiance, and an increasing focus on architecturally sophisticated chalets and modern apartments. Residents experience tranquil privacy, with seamless access to renowned slopes and summer pursuits like hiking and golf. Architectural integrity, panoramic views, and proximity to both Kitzbühel and Salzburg make this enclave a favored retreat for international families, investors, and those seeking both exclusivity and genuine connection to the heart of the Alps.
Mittersill / Pass Thurn luxury properties attract Austrian and international buyers seeking second homes or income-producing investments. Demand remains resilient due to proximity to Kitzbühel and direct ski access.
Trophy chalets and newly built apartments hold strong value, while supply stays cautiously limited and timing for listings reflects discerning ownership cycles.
The property landscape is defined by select high-elevation chalets, newly constructed apartments, and a small number of historic conversions. Most premier homes occupy hillside settings, capturing panoramic valley and mountain views. Coveted addresses lie near the Passthurn ski lifts, high above the town center, and along the scenic stretches approaching Kitzbühel.
Market turnover is steady yet limited, governed by Austria’s controlled development policies, supporting long-term demand and value preservation. Alpine craftsmanship prevails, with a blend of sustainable materials and contemporary interior design.
A Place to Live and Invest in Mittersill / Pass Thurn
Nestled in the heart of the Austrian Alps, Mittersill / Pass Thurn draws those in search of both timeless escape and long-term value. The area’s special status as an authentic mountain village, coupled with the draw of year-round outdoor pursuits, enhances desirability. Acquisitions typically include traditional chalets, new alpine residences, and the rare apartment offering, often featuring generous terraces, high levels of privacy, and direct access to the KitzSki skiing region. Robust infrastructure, established international schools nearby, and protected natural surroundings attract cosmopolitan families and investors alike.
Purchasing real estate here typically follows Austrian conventions, with clear title processes, due diligence requirements, and notarized contracts. International buyers are welcome, though certain restrictions apply for non-EU citizens and in areas classified for primary residence. Listings are infrequently public; transactions often occur off-market, leveraging established agency networks. Financing is locally available for EU residents, and a modest transfer tax applies. Buyers frequently favor new-build chalets due to sustainable credentials and integrated wellness features.
Short- and long-term rental markets are underpinned by demand from international ski tourists and summer visitors. Properties suitable for rental use generally require adherence to zoning and licensing criteria. High occupancy rates are common during winter, particularly for high-standard chalets with spa amenities and direct ski access. Professional property management services handle guest relations, maintenance, and legal compliance, providing seamless ownership experience for investors focused on yield.

Austria’s strong legal framework underpins real estate investments in Mittersill / Pass Thurn. Infrastructure is robust—reliable road and rail connections link residents to Salzburg and Munich. Local governance prioritizes sustainable growth, with careful protection of Alpine landscapes. Year-round tourism—anchored by the KitzSki region—bolsters economic resilience and encourages ongoing hospitality investment. The area benefits from Austria's international reputation for safety and transparency.
Ongoing costs for luxury homeowners include utilities—typically moderate due to modern insulation—plus snow clearance in winter months. Professional staff or concierge services are common for larger chalets. Private dining, both at home and in local farm-to-table restaurants, reflects the area’s emphasis on quality. Comparative living expenses align with prominent Austrian resort areas, with property taxes and municipal fees kept reasonable by regional standards. The cost structure appeals to those seeking both comfort and long-term stability.
Life here unfolds amidst breathtaking peaks and a vibrant local culture. Residents enjoy direct access to one of the Alps’ best ski domains, along with summer golf, hiking, and gourmet farm shops. Community engagement is authentic, with regular classical concerts, art exhibitions, and regional festivals.
Wellness is deeply rooted, evident in spa amenities, fresh alpine air, and outdoor activity programs. The blend of privacy with a cosmopolitan atmosphere ensures a rewarding experience for both residents and frequent visitors.
This region enjoys four distinct seasons. Winter reliably brings deep snowfall, ideal for skiing, while spring and summer are marked by lush meadows and warm, sunlit days perfect for outdoor pursuits.
Autumn is appreciated for vivid foliage and a quieter tempo. Year-round, the air remains crisp, and sunset views across the Hohe Tauern peaks provide a daily highlight for homeowners seeking an invigorating Alpine environment.
